    Who is Dr. Kuryla, Family Medicine Specialist in Warrenton, OR?

    Dr. Karen Kuryla, MD is a Family Medicine Specialist, who primarily practices in Warrenton, OR with 2 additional practice locations. She has been practicing for over 33 years and is board certified by the American Board of Family Medicine. Dr. Kuryla completed her residency at Aultman Hospital. Dr. Kuryla is fluent in English,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Kuryla’s practice accepts Kaiser Permanente, Medicaid, Medicare, UnitedHealthcare and other major insurance plans.     What is Dr. Karen Kuryla's specialty?

    Dr. Kuryla is a Family Medicine Specialist near Warrenton, OR. Family Medicine is a medical specialty focused on comprehensive healthcare for individuals and families. It is a broad field that integrates biological, clinical, and behavioral sciences. The scope of family medicine covers all ages, genders, organ systems, and disease conditions, offering a holistic approach to patient care. Contact Dr. Kuryla to book an appointment today.

    Is this Dr. Karen Kuryla aff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Kuryla is affiliated with Columbia Memorial Hospital which is a Castle Connolly Top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
